My studio is located outside the city on the territory of gardens and in autumn, when the foliage falls and summer residents leave their gardens, it becomes clear what is growing in neighbor beds. Last fall, passing by a neighbor's plot, I saw this amazingly beautiful blooming ornamental cabbage on the black loosened earth. So luxurious in shape and color shades that I immediately wanted to photograph it in order to depict it later in painting.
For the composition of the picture, I chose the theme of the love chase of two rabbits, or rather the white rabbit running away and the hare chasing it. Apparently, the white rabbit is a female and it can be assumed that, as she runs away, she thinks: “Am I running too fast?” As for the hare chasing her, this is a male who, at the moment of the chase, turns his head to the viewer and asks with a glance: “Look how gorgeous I am!” All this action takes place against the backdrop of black earth and bright pink flowering cabbage.

Natalie Levkovska is an experienced Lithuanian painter and illustrator. In 1995, she obtained a degree in stone, bone and wood processing from a master artist (Abramtsevo College of Applied Arts), and in 1999 she completed a degree in costume design (Vilnius Academy of Arts). She then became a costume designer for the cinema industry, and later a fur designer. In 2006, she decided to change her life: she moved to London to work in a design studio, and started to experiment oil painting.

She creates simple and poetic artworks, mixing surrealism and naive art. Her artistic universe is a kind of magic realism: she likes to show real life objects and try to bring out the magical pulsation of space. The plots of her creations are taken from her life: a birch glade near her house at different times of the year, the portrait of a loved one, her village in the snow... 

Natalie Levkovska have organized 19 personal exhibitions, participated in a lot of paintings and drawings events, and her drawings can be found in many private collections.
